关于布局的一点心得
2013-07-12 17:31
225 查看
1,要善于运用0dp结合layout_weight来填充剩余空间
2,对于高度,其实很多时候不需要高度必须为wrap_content;可以直接规定为具体数值
3,多使用这个属性: android:gravity="center_vertical";这个结合上一条在很多时候很好用
4,在listview、gridview等控件中,记得加上这个属性: android:cacheColorHint="@null"
5,只有父标签为relativelayout的时候,控件才具有以下属性:android:layout_below、android:layout_alignParentTop等相对布局属性;不过大部分布局都具有layout_gravity属性,可以控制相对于父控件的位置。只有帧布局才能够实现图像的重叠效果。
6,如果需要去除android的checkbox的默认边框,
需要使用这个属性 ,android:button;创建一个selector 的xml文件即可
,
2,对于高度,其实很多时候不需要高度必须为wrap_content;可以直接规定为具体数值
3,多使用这个属性: android:gravity="center_vertical";这个结合上一条在很多时候很好用
4,在listview、gridview等控件中,记得加上这个属性: android:cacheColorHint="@null"
5,只有父标签为relativelayout的时候,控件才具有以下属性:android:layout_below、android:layout_alignParentTop等相对布局属性;不过大部分布局都具有layout_gravity属性,可以控制相对于父控件的位置。只有帧布局才能够实现图像的重叠效果。
6,如果需要去除android的checkbox的默认边框,
需要使用这个属性 ,android:button;创建一个selector 的xml文件即可
,
相关文章推荐
- 关于div布局的一点心得
- 写一下今天的收获吧,如:截取屏幕图片并保存,单击“空白返回上一页”,一点关于布局的小心得
- 关于Firefox、Safari 与IE区别实际应用的一点心得
- 关于C语言字符串函数使用的一点心得
- 关于JS的一点心得
- Unity 关于CombineMeshes的一点使用心得
- VC++中关于ListControl排序的一点心得[原创]
- 关于软件设计的一点心得体会
- 关于多行文字水平垂直居中的一点心得分享
- 关于伪静态和真静态的一点心得
- 关于使用JScrollPane的一点心得
- 关于做Android+J2ee系统集成开发的一点心得
- 开发手机Widget关于页面css渲染的一点心得
- [转载]关于文件系统和磁盘驱动的一点学习心得
- 关于破解网络验证的一点心得
- 关于rand和srand函数使用的一点心得
- 关于UILabel的一点使用心得
- [转贴]关于exe形式编程的一点心得,希望对大家有所帮助
- 关于乱码的一点小小的心得
- 关于用VC,VB进行图像数据(二进制大对象)存储数据库的一点心得